CAPITAL INVESTMENT JUSTIFICATIONFISCAL YEAR (FY) 2012 BUDGET ESTIMATES($ IN THOUSANDS) FEBRUARY 2011DEPARTMENT OF THE NAVY / TRANSPORTATION / MILITARYSEALIFT COMMAND#003 ‐ SOFTWARE DEVELOPMENT MILITARY SEALIFT COMMAND(MSC)FY 2010 FY 2011 FY 2012Software DevelopmentQuant Unit Cost Total Cost Quant Unit Cost Total Cost Quant Unit Cost Total CostMSC ‐ Financial Management System 1 $ 1,260 $ 1,2601 $ 1,860 $ 1,8601 $ 3,140 $ 3,140TOTAL 1 $ 1,260 $ 1,2601 $ 1,860 $ 1,8601 $ 3,140 $ 3,140Justification:Software Development:FMS: This is a DOD/DFAS migratory finance and accounting system. It is consistent with the requirements of the Financial Integrity Act, Anti‐Deficiency Act, Joint Financial ManagementImprovment Program (JMIP), and the Chief Financial Officer (CFO) Act. This initiative will provide for cross functional requirements and continuing development of enhancement and upgrades toMSC business systems. Supports the introduction of additional modules required to provide a total automated procure to pay solution for MSC. It also will support the development of interfacesrequired with external systems ‐ e.g. DOD wide implementation of the End ‐to‐End procurement process. Estimates do include requirement to replace current MSC budget development tool (BPS.)Current budget system is not integrated with other MSC business sytems. The replacement system will solve this shortcoming.Software addresses remediation of DOD IG audit findings.
